Jim Cramer Says He Likes These Three Communications Services Stocks for 2023


CNBC’s Jim Cramer offered investors a list of three communications services stocks that are buys in an otherwise “untouchable” group.
The communications services sector, one of 11 in the S&P 500, includes traditional telecommunications companies, media and entertainment companies and some large Internet companies.
“In a terrible year for stocks, communications services was the worst performing group in the S&P 500, which is really saying something,” he said. “Most of them are simply untouchable, but you have my blessing to buy” T-Mobile, Disney and Netflix.
Here are his thoughts on each stock:
Cramer called the company the best wireless carrier in the country and said he believes in the stock’s ability to shoot.
Disney will turn itself around now that CEO Bob Iger has returned to the helm, he predicted.
While Netflix struggled earlier this year due to subscriber losses, the company has since seen subscriber growth and introduced an ad-supported tier to help fill the balance. “I feel better and better about Netflix,” Cramer said.
